Proper blood flow is a fundamental aspect of maintaining overall health, as it plays a critical role in delivering essential nutrients and oxygen to every cell in the body. Blood, a remarkable fluid consisting of red blood cells, white blood cells, platelets, and plasma, circulates through a vast network of arteries, veins, and capillaries. This intricate system ensures that oxygen is supplied to tissues while removing carbon dioxide and other metabolic wastes. Understanding how proper blood flow increases oxygen supply is crucial for recognizing the importance of cardiovascular health.

When blood flows efficiently, it ensures that oxygen-rich blood can reach various organs and tissues. The heart pumps oxygenated blood from the lungs into the arterial system, where it is carried to the body’s periphery. Each heartbeat propels blood through arteries, which branch into smaller arterioles and eventually lead to capillaries, the site of nutrient and gas exchange. Here, oxygen is released from red blood cells and diffuses into nearby tissues to fulfill metabolic needs. Conversely, carbon dioxide, which is produced as a metabolic byproduct, moves from the tissues into the blood to be transported back to the lungs for exhalation.

However, when blood flow is compromised due to various factors such as arterial blockages, high blood pressure, or medical conditions like atherosclerosis, the delivery of oxygen to cells becomes inefficient. Insufficient oxygen supply can lead to fatigue, impaired bodily functions, and, in severe cases, tissue damage or necrosis. Thus, ensuring optimal blood flow is vital for maintaining high levels of oxygen in the body.

Several lifestyle choices can enhance blood flow, which in turn boosts oxygen supply. Regular physical exercise is one of the most effective ways to promote circulation. Engaging in aerobic activities such as walking, running, swimming, or cycling strengthens the heart muscle, allowing it to pump blood more efficiently. Additionally, exercise promotes the dilation of blood vessels, which increases blood flow and lowers blood pressure, facilitating better oxygen distribution to tissues.

Healthy dietary choices also play a significant role in supporting cardiovascular health. Consuming a diet r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, lean proteins, and healthy fats can help reduce inflammation and improve blood flow. Certain nutrients, such as omega-3 fatty acids found in fish and flaxseeds, are known to promote healthy circulation by reducing blood viscosity and improving endothelial function. Staying hydrated is equally important, as dehydration can lead to thicker blood, which makes it more difficult for the heart to pump effectively.

In addition to lifestyle choices, specific supplements may support optimal blood flow. Natural products like beetroot juice, which contains nitrates, can enhance blood flow and lower blood pressure. Similarly, supplements that promote nitric oxide production can lead to vasodilation, improving circulation and oxygen delivery throughout the body. Stress management is another crucial factor for maintaining proper blood flow. Chronic stress can lead to inflammation and constricted blood vessels, which may impede circulation. Incorporating relaxation techniques like yoga, meditation, or deep-breathing exercises can help mitigate stress responses and support vascular health.

Ultimately, the relationship between blood flow and oxygen supply is a vital component of overall health and well-being. By adopting a holistic approach that includes regular exercise, a balanced diet, proper hydration, effective stress management, and potentially beneficial supplements, individuals can enhance their cardiovascular health. Improving blood flow not only increases oxygen supply but also revitalizes the body, improves energy levels, and supports optimal organ function, leading to a healthier and more vibrant life.

When many people think of oral health, they often reduce it to a matter of aesthetics: a white smile, fresh breath, or the absence of cavities. While these factors undeniably play a role in how we perceive our appearance and feel about ourselves, the implications of poor oral health extend far beyond mere cosmetic concerns. In reality, oral health is deeply intertwined with overall physical health, emotional well-being, and even social interactions.

The mouth is often referred to as the “gateway to the body,” and for good reason. Oral health issues can lead to a variety of systemic health problems. For example, periodontal disease, an infection of the gums, is not just confined to the mouth; it has been linked to conditions such as heart disease, diabetes, respiratory diseases, and even Alzheimer’s disease. Chronic inflammation stemming from gum disease may contribute to the development of these serious conditions by increasing systemic inflammation. Therefore, maintaining good oral hygiene—brushing, flossing, and regular dental check-ups—is essential for holistic health.

Moreover, oral health can have a significant impact on nutritional status. Conditions like tooth decay and gum disease can lead to pain while eating, which may cause individuals to avoid certain foods. This can restrict diet quality and lead to nutritional deficiencies over time. For instance, if someone experiences pain when chewing fresh fruits and vegetables, they may opt for softer, less nutritious foods. Over time, these dietary changes can contribute to more severe health issues, including obesity and malnutrition.

In addition to physical health implications, poor oral health can affect emotional and psychological well-being. Individuals with dental issues often face embarrassment or anxiety about their appearance, leading to lowered self-esteem. This can hinder social interactions and participation in activities, creating a cycle of isolation and further mental health problems such as depression or social phobias. Studies have shown a strong correlation between poor oral health and mental health disorders, suggesting that caring for one’s mouth is also an act of self-care and self-love.

Financial implications also arise from neglecting oral health. Dental problems can become costly if not addressed early on. For example, a small cavity can typically be filled with minimal expenses, but left untreated, it may develop into a root canal or even require tooth extraction. These more invasive procedures come with significantly higher costs and can lead to lost work time and increased healthcare expenses. Preventive care is crucial for avoiding these potential financial burdens, making routine dental visits a worthwhile investment in one’s overall well-being.

Lastly, the contributions of good oral health practices extend into community health. When individuals prioritize their oral health, they help reduce the burden on healthcare systems. Preventive oral care can lead to fewer emergency dental visits, which often occur due to avoidable conditions. This alleviates pressure on healthcare resources and allows them to serve those in need more effectively.

In conclusion, the significance of oral health cannot be simplified to cosmetic appearances alone. It encompasses a multifaceted realm of physical, emotional, and financial well-being. Maintaining good oral health is a crucial component of overall health; it helps to prevent systemic illnesses, supports mental health, reduces healthcare costs, and promotes community wellness. Therefore, it is essential to take oral hygiene seriously—not just for a brighter smile but for a healthier life. By recognizing the importance of Oral Health, we empower ourselves and those around us to live healthier, happier lives.
